[0058] In the embodiment of the present invention, based on the multi-process HARQ processing mechanism, the base station estimates the remaining buffer space that the current UE can provide in real time through the evaluation of the current channel quality, the buffer capacity of the UE, and the occupancy of the buffer, and self-adapts according to the remaining buffer space. Adjust the number of available downlink processes, and when the remaining buffer space provided by the UE is insufficient, adaptively adjust the transport block size (Transport Block Size, TBS), thereby ensuring the reliability of downlink data transmission and improving the utilization of resources Rate.
